English-5 Viewing the Connection Panel Whenever you connect an audio or video system to your set, ensure that all elements are switched off. Refer to the documentation supplied with your equipment for detailed connection instructions and associated safety precautions. Power Input Option < LW17M24C / LW17M24CU > < LW15M23C / LW20M21C / LW20M22C > SCART Power Input Viewing the Connection Panel Connecting an Aerial or Cable Television Network (depending on the model) To view television channels correctly, a signal must be received by the set from one of the following sources: -An outdoor aerial -A cable television network -A satellite network Connecting a Set-Top Box, VCR or DVD -Connect the VCR, or DVD SCART cable to the SCART connector of the VCR, or DVD. -If you wish to connect both the Set-Top Box and VCR (or DVD), you should connect the Set-Top Box to the VCR (or DVD) and connect the VCR (or DVD) to your set. Connecting a Computer -Connect the 15 Pin D-SUB connector to the PC video connector. -Connect the stereo audio cable to the “PC AUDIO IN (STEREO)” jack ( )on the rear of your set and the other end to the “Audio Out” jack of the sound card on your computer. . 15 Pin D-SUB connector Pin Separate H/V Composite H/V 1 Red (R) Red (R) 2 Green (G) Green (G) 3 Blue (B) Blue (B) 4 Grounding Grounding 5 Grounding (DDC return) Grounding (DDC return) 6 Grounding - Red (R) Grounding - Red (R) 7 Grounding - Green (G) Grounding - Green (G) 8 Grounding - Blue (B) Grounding - Blue (B) 9 No connection No connection 10 Grounding - Sync. / Self test Grounding - Sync. / Self test 11 Grounding Grounding 12 DDC - SDA (Data) DDC - SDA (Data) 13 Horizontal Sync. Horizontal/Vertical Sync. 14 Vertical Sync. Not used 15 DDC - SCL (Clock) DDC - SCL (Clock) English-6 Viewing the Connection Panel Connecting External A/V Devices -Connect RCA or S-VIDEO cables to an appropriate external A/V device such as a VCR, DVD or Camcorder. -Connect RCA audio cables to “(MONO)L-AUDIO-R” on the rear of your set and the other ends to corresponding audio out connectors on the A/V device. Connecting Headphones -Plug a set of headphones into the 3.5mm mini-jack socket on the right-side of the set. While the headphones are connected, the sound from the built-in speakers will be disabled. Kensington Slot -This television has been designed to apply a burglarproof lock.(...
